Clover Valley Protein Trail Mix
Summary
This trail mix is composed of minimally processed ingredients such as peanuts, almonds, and dried fruits, which are rich in healthy fats, protein, and antioxidants. The absence of harmful additives or seed oils and the presence of nutrient-dense components contribute to its high rating. Its natural sweetness comes from dried fruits, providing a wholesome snack option with beneficial nutrients.
At a glance
Key ingredients 6
PeanutsGood
Peanuts are a good source of protein and healthy fats, making them a nutritious snack option. They contain monounsaturated fats that support heart health. Additionally, peanuts provide essential vitamins and minerals such as vitamin E and magnesium.
Risks
Peanuts can be a common allergen and may cause allergic reactions in sensitive individuals.
Benefits
Rich in protein and healthy fats, peanuts support heart health and provide essential nutrients.
RaisinsGood
Raisins are dried grapes that offer natural sweetness and are a source of antioxidants. They provide dietary fiber which aids in digestion. Raisins also contain iron and potassium, contributing to overall health.
Risks
Raisins are high in natural sugars, which can contribute to calorie intake if consumed in large quantities.
Benefits
Provide antioxidants and dietary fiber, supporting digestive health and offering natural sweetness.
AlmondsVery Good
Almonds are nutrient-dense nuts rich in healthy monounsaturated fats and vitamin E. They support heart health and provide a good source of protein and fiber. Almonds also contain magnesium, which is important for bone health.
Benefits
Rich in healthy fats, protein, and fiber, almonds support heart and bone health.
PepitasGood
Pepitas, or pumpkin seeds, are a good source of healthy fats, protein, and essential minerals like zinc and magnesium. They support immune function and heart health. Pepitas also provide antioxidants that help reduce inflammation.
Benefits
Provide healthy fats, protein, and essential minerals, supporting immune and heart health.
CashewsGood
Cashews are rich in healthy fats and provide a good source of protein and essential minerals like copper and magnesium. They support heart health and contribute to bone strength. Cashews also contain antioxidants that help protect against oxidative stress.
Risks
Cashews can be a common allergen and may cause allergic reactions in sensitive individuals.
Benefits
Rich in healthy fats and protein, cashews support heart health and provide essential nutrients.
Dried CherriesGood
Dried cherries offer natural sweetness and are a source of antioxidants, particularly anthocyanins. They support heart health and may help reduce inflammation. Dried cherries also provide dietary fiber, aiding in digestion.
Risks
Dried cherries are high in natural sugars, which can contribute to calorie intake if consumed in large quantities.
Benefits
Provide antioxidants and dietary fiber, supporting heart health and offering natural sweetness.
